- 基本了解Python编程
- 熟悉AI代理或LLM的概念
- 对构建基于代理的系统感兴趣
受众
- 开发者
- 技术负责人
- AI爱好者
CrewAI 是一個開源框架,用於創建和協作AI代理,以自主完成複雜任務。
這是一個由講師指導的培訓(線上或線下),適合初學者,旨在探索CrewAI的基礎知識,並構建簡單的多代理系統。
在培訓結束時,參與者將能夠:
- 理解CrewAI的架構和設計原則。
- 在代理團隊中定義角色、任務和流程。
- 使用CrewAI的框架創建協作工作流程。
- 構建、測試和運行基本的多代理場景。
課程形式
- 互動式講座和討論。
- 大量練習和實踐。
- 在實時實驗室環境中進行動手操作。
課程定制選項
- 如需為本課程定制培訓,請聯繫我們安排。
CrewAI 簡介
- CrewAI 概覽及其目的
- 自主代理協作的實際應用案例
- 核心組件:代理、角色、任務、流程
CrewAI 的安裝與設置
- 安裝與環境設置
- 專案結構與基本配置
- 連接 LLM 提供者(OpenAI 等)
定義代理角色與職責
- 創建自定義代理角色
- 分配能力與職責
- 管理上下文與提示
設計任務與工作流程
- 理解任務結構與依賴關係
- 使用流程實施工作流程
- 鏈接與協調多代理操作
測試與除錯 Crews
- 在開發模式下運行代理
- 監控互動與日誌
- 迭代設計與行為
構建範例專案
- 設計一個簡單的內容研究代理團隊
- 執行專案並分析結果
- 探索變體與改進
總結與下一步
United Arab Emirates - Getting Started with CrewAI
Qatar - Getting Started with CrewAI
Egypt - Getting Started with CrewAI
Saudi Arabia - Getting Started with CrewAI
South Africa - Getting Started with CrewAI
Brasil - Getting Started with CrewAI
Canada - Getting Started with CrewAI
中国 - Getting Started with CrewAI
香港 - Getting Started with CrewAI
澳門 - Getting Started with CrewAI
台灣 - Getting Started with CrewAI
USA - Getting Started with CrewAI
Österreich - Getting Started with CrewAI
Schweiz - Getting Started with CrewAI
Deutschland - Getting Started with CrewAI
Czech Republic - Getting Started with CrewAI
Denmark - Getting Started with CrewAI
Estonia - Getting Started with CrewAI
Finland - Getting Started with CrewAI
Greece - Getting Started with CrewAI
Magyarország - Getting Started with CrewAI
Ireland - Getting Started with CrewAI
Luxembourg - Getting Started with CrewAI
Latvia - Getting Started with CrewAI
España - Getting Started with CrewAI
Italia - Getting Started with CrewAI
Lithuania - Getting Started with CrewAI
Nederland - Getting Started with CrewAI
Norway - Getting Started with CrewAI
Portugal - Getting Started with CrewAI
România - Getting Started with CrewAI
Sverige - Getting Started with CrewAI
Türkiye - Getting Started with CrewAI
Malta - Getting Started with CrewAI
Belgique - Getting Started with CrewAI
France - Getting Started with CrewAI
日本 - Getting Started with CrewAI
Australia - Getting Started with CrewAI
Malaysia - Getting Started with CrewAI
New Zealand - Getting Started with CrewAI
Philippines - Getting Started with CrewAI
Singapore - Getting Started with CrewAI
Thailand - Getting Started with CrewAI
Vietnam - Getting Started with CrewAI
India - Getting Started with CrewAI
Argentina - Getting Started with CrewAI
Chile - Getting Started with CrewAI
Costa Rica - Getting Started with CrewAI
Ecuador - Getting Started with CrewAI
Guatemala - Getting Started with CrewAI
Colombia - Getting Started with CrewAI
México - Getting Started with CrewAI
Panama - Getting Started with CrewAI
Peru - Getting Started with CrewAI
Uruguay - Getting Started with CrewAI
Venezuela - Getting Started with CrewAI
Polska - Getting Started with CrewAI
United Kingdom - Getting Started with CrewAI
South Korea - Getting Started with CrewAI
Pakistan - Getting Started with CrewAI
Sri Lanka - Getting Started with CrewAI
Bulgaria - Getting Started with CrewAI
Bolivia - Getting Started with CrewAI
Indonesia - Getting Started with CrewAI
Kazakhstan - Getting Started with CrewAI
Moldova - Getting Started with CrewAI
Morocco - Getting Started with CrewAI
Tunisia - Getting Started with CrewAI
Kuwait - Getting Started with CrewAI
Oman - Getting Started with CrewAI
Slovakia - Getting Started with CrewAI
Kenya - Getting Started with CrewAI
Nigeria - Getting Started with CrewAI
Botswana - Getting Started with CrewAI
Slovenia - Getting Started with CrewAI
Croatia - Getting Started with CrewAI
Serbia - Getting Started with CrewAI
Bhutan - Getting Started with CrewAI